In the senior school we been have been learning about rocket designs and Newton's Laws of Motion. We have learnt about how to be safe when launching your rockets. There are some important safety rules that you need to follow when launching a rocket here are some of them are:

  • wait until the rockets has landed before you go to retrieve it
  • don't launch your rocket when it is a windy or rainy day
  • wear safety googles and a hi-vis vest 

We also learnt about the part of the rockets are like:
  • the top of the rocket is called a nosecone 
  • 4 forces thrust, drag,weight and lift


We learnt how to launch a rocket like:
  • no more then 60pis or it will explode 
  • lots of water = FAILURE (won't go high or it won't fly)


we learnt how to create rockets using bottle, we used cardboard to make fins and PAPER planes
